Cамоучитель по Assembler

         

П6. Действие команды rol.




В качестве операнда можно указывать любой регистр (кроме сегментного) или ячейку памяти размером как в байт, так и в слово. Не допускается использовать в качестве операнда непосредственное значение. Команда воздействует на флаги OF и CF.

Пример


mov AX,1
rol AX,1 ;AX=0002h, CF=0

Пример


mov DL,8 Oh
rol DL,1 ;DL=01h, CF=1

Пример


mov DX,3000h
mov CL,4
rol DX,CL ;DX=0003h, CF=1

Пример


mov DX,2000h
mov CL,4
rol DX,CL ;DX=0002h, CF=0


Пример



mov ЕАХ,012345678h
rol EАХ,16 ;EAX=56781234h



Содержание  Назад  Вперед